OVH Community, votre nouvel espace communautaire.

2 problème: redirection; moteurs de recherche.


Hyaka
08/03/2009, 09h48
J'ai le même problème avec l'installation d'un wiki sauf que je n'ai pas de fichier accueil et uniquement un fichier php qui dit cela. Est-ce que cela peut venir de là ? D'avance merci.

$preIP = dirname( __FILE__ );
require_once( "$preIP/includes/WebStart.php" );

# Initialize MediaWiki base class
require_once( "$preIP/includes/Wiki.php" );
$mediaWiki = new MediaWiki();

wfProfileIn( 'main-misc-setup' );
OutputPage::setEncodings(); # Not really used yet

$maxLag = $wgRequest->getVal( 'maxlag' );
if( !is_null($maxLag) && !$mediaWiki->checkMaxLag( $maxLag ) ) {
exit;
}

# Query string fields
$action = $wgRequest->getVal( 'action', 'view' );
$title = $wgRequest->getVal( 'title' );

$wgTitle = $mediaWiki->checkInitialQueries( $title, $action );
if( $wgTitle === NULL ) {
unset( $wgTitle );
}

wfProfileOut( 'main-misc-setup' );

#
# Send Ajax requests to the Ajax dispatcher.
#
if( $wgUseAjax && $action == 'ajax' ) {
require_once( $IP . '/includes/AjaxDispatcher.php' );
$dispatcher = new AjaxDispatcher();
$dispatcher->performAction();
$mediaWiki->restInPeace();
exit;
}

if( $wgUseFileCache && isset($wgTitle) ) {
wfProfileIn( 'main-try-filecache' );
// Raw pages should handle cache control on their own,
// even when using file cache. This reduces hits from clients.
if( $action != 'raw' && HTMLFileCache::useFileCache() ) {
/* Try low-level file cache hit */
$cache = new HTMLFileCache( $wgTitle, $action );
if( $cache->isFileCacheGood( /* Assume up to date */ ) ) {
/* Check incoming headers to see if client has this cached */
if( !$wgOut->checkLastModified( $cache->fileCacheTime() ) ) {
$cache->loadFromFileCache();
}
# Do any stats increment/watchlist stuff
$wgArticle = MediaWiki::articleFromTitle( $wgTitle );
$wgArticle->viewUpdates();
# Tell $wgOut that output is taken care of
wfProfileOut( 'main-try-filecache' );
$mediaWiki->restInPeace();
exit;
}
}
wfProfileOut( 'main-try-filecache' );
}

# Setting global variables in mediaWiki
$mediaWiki->setVal( 'action', $action );
$mediaWiki->setVal( 'CommandLineMode', $wgCommandLineMode );
$mediaWiki->setVal( 'DisabledActions', $wgDisabledActions );
$mediaWiki->setVal( 'DisableHardRedirects', $wgDisableHardRedirects );
$mediaWiki->setVal( 'DisableInternalSearch', $wgDisableInternalSearch );
$mediaWiki->setVal( 'EnableCreativeCommonsRdf', $wgEnableCreativeCommonsRdf );
$mediaWiki->setVal( 'EnableDublinCoreRdf', $wgEnableDublinCoreRdf );
$mediaWiki->setVal( 'JobRunRate', $wgJobRunRate );
$mediaWiki->setVal( 'Server', $wgServer );
$mediaWiki->setVal( 'SquidMaxage', $wgSquidMaxage );
$mediaWiki->setVal( 'UseExternalEditor', $wgUseExternalEditor );
$mediaWiki->setVal( 'UsePathInfo', $wgUsePathInfo );

$mediaWiki->initialize( $wgTitle, $wgArticle, $wgOut, $wgUser, $wgRequest );
$mediaWiki->finalCleanup( $wgDeferredUpdateList, $wgOut );

# Not sure when $wgPostCommitUpdateList gets set, so I keep this separate from finalCleanup
$mediaWiki->doUpdates( $wgPostCommitUpdateList );

$mediaWiki->restInPeace();

Zora bleu
07/03/2009, 22h37
Et bien je te remercie beaucoup! ^^

Le premier problème est déjà résolu, et sans aide j'aurais jamais trouvé. :-\

Je vais maintenant m'attaquer au deuxième, et je dirais à mon amis qu'il a oublié de faire la mise à jours de ses informations crânienne.

Merci.

enycu
07/03/2009, 21h57
Redirection: D'abord, tu dois effacer le fichier index.html et le dossier memo qui se trouvent dans le dossier www.
Ensuite, le fichier par défaut DOIT avoir l'un des 3 noms suivant, et aucun autre n'est accepté: index.html, index.htm et index.php. Je t'invite à respecter ce principe de base. Donc, tu dois remplacer le nom de fichier Accueil.html par index.html (sans majuscule). Efface les liens vers le fichier Accueil.html en index.html dans tes fichiers html.

Moteur de recherche: c'est bien plus compliqué que ça. Regarde le lien dans ma signature. Et informe ton copain administrateur qu'il a 10 ans de retard

Zora bleu
07/03/2009, 21h45
Bonsoir.

Je viens demander de l'aide pour deux problèmes que je n'arrive pas à résoudre... Même avec les guides (j'y ai fouillé toute la soirée d'hier... ).

Je vais commencer par le problème le moins important, et le plus simple à résoudre, car c'est quelque chose qui se fait habituellement sur un site, mais je ne trouve pas où le modifier.
Avant tout autre chose, je vous dis (on sait jamais si cela intervient dans la procédure...) que je dispose de l'offre start1g.

La redirection:
Lorsque vous allez sur mon site: www.skatexpo.fr, une redirection à lieu vers http://www.skatexpo.fr/memo/index.html (d'aide OVH en temps normal mais que j'ai modifié), ceci se passe depuis que j'ai créer le compte, je pense que c'est normal.

Mais j'aimerais que la redirection se fasse vers la page http://www.skatexpo.fr/Accueil.html.
Le gros problème, c'est que je ne trouve pas où changer ceci...

Techniquement c'est possible, des sites que je connais change l'adresse de redirection, quand il ont un splash ou non. Et puis cela n'aurait pas de sens de ne pas pouvoir tomber directement sur le site...

Est-ce que quelqu'un peut m'aider sur ce problème s'il vous plait?




Le second problème... Les moteurs de recherche:

Je pense que ce problème est plus embêtant à résoudre même s'il est plus court à expliquer.

En fait, mon site, www.skatexpo.fr, n'apparait sur aucun moteur de recherche, ou du moins, ni sur Google, ni sur Exalead.

Comment cela se fait? Comment puis-je le faire apparaitre sur ces moteurs de recherche?
(Un administrateur, donc s'y connaissant un minimum m'a dit que cela pouvait venir sur l'ancienneté du site [car ce sont des BOT qui repèrent les sites], le site a maintenant 1 semaine et 1 jour, est-ce que cela pourrait venir de ça? )


Voilà tout, je remercie d'avance les personnes qui m'aideront même si je les remercierais encore, je le sais! XD